COLLEGE PARK, MD -- Jack Koras and
Luke Wierman were named the Big Ten Offensive Player and Specialist of the Week, respectively. The No. 9 Terps are coming off a 13-11 come-from-behind win over then-No. 4 Penn State on Sunday evening.
Koras scored a game-high four goals to help orchestrate a thrilling Maryland comeback over No. 4 Penn State. The Terps were down by as many as five goals and trailed by three heading into the fourth quarter when Koras scored two goals in the first 26 seconds of the fourth. He also scooped four groundballs and played a crucial role on the wing to help Maryland win 17-of-28 face-offs. The Terps are 41-1 against Penn State all time now.
Wierman finished 16-of-27 at the faceoff dot and tied his career-high with two assists. He won 11 of 14 face-offs in the second half.
Koras wins his second-ever Big Ten Weekly honor and first this season. Wierman earns his third this season and eight of his career. Five different Terps have now won a conference honor this month.
